Things You'll Need:
- Hostel membership (you can usually join at the front desk while signing in)
-
Step 1
Stay at a hostel and save money and have a wonderful experience too. Hostels are found in many cities and offer an inexpensive place to stay.
-
Step 2
Make new friends at the hostel. Hostels are full of international travelers. You will meet people from all over the world. There are many common rooms in hostel such as the TV room, the lounge, and the breakfast area so it is easy to meet people. You will have new friends to share activities with.
-
Step 3
Participate in the activities the hostel offers. Many hostels offer walking tours, van tours to local attractions, yoga classes, movies, group dinners, seminars and many other activities.
-
Step 4
Save money on food by cooking in the communal kitchen. Eating every meal out while traveling gets very tedious. Hostels give you a place to store and cook food. The communal dining rooms are full of interesting conversations.
-
Step 5
Pick the hostel experience you want. Hostels offer private rooms or rooms with two or more bunks. The bathrooms are typically down the hall and are usually very clean and offer lots of hot water.
